Best Practices for E-commerce Content Strategy
Content strategy isn't just about what you create; it's also about how you create it. Here are some best practices to keep in mind:
Consistency is Key
Maintaining a consistent content schedule and brand voice is crucial. This builds trust and familiarity with your audience. Whether it's daily blog posts, weekly newsletters, or monthly social media campaigns, consistency keeps your audience engaged and your brand top-of-mind.
Personalization and Segmentation
Personalized content is more effective than generic messaging. Learn how to segment your audience based on demographics, behavior, and preferences. Tailoring content to different segments ensures that each user feels valued and understood, increasing the likelihood of conversion.
Storytelling Techniques
Storytelling is a powerful tool in content strategy. It helps create an emotional connection with your audience. You'll learn how to weave compelling narratives into your product descriptions, blog posts, and marketing campaigns, making your brand more relatable and memorable.
Continuous Optimization
Content strategy is an ongoing process. Regularly review and optimize your content based on performance metrics. A/B testing, user feedback, and trend analysis can provide valuable insights to refine your strategy continually.
